|author||Tom Ryder <firstname.lastname@example.org>||2017-11-04 18:42:52 +1300|
|committer||Tom Ryder <email@example.com>||2017-11-04 18:42:52 +1300|
Merge branch 'feature/vim-plugin-...' into develop
* feature/vim-plugin-readme: Add heading for Vim plugins subsection Update README to mention Vim plugins
1 files changed, 13 insertions, 1 deletions
@@ -343,10 +343,22 @@ The configuration is broken into subfiles in `~/.vim/config/*.vim`, included by
extensively commented, mostly because I was reading through it one day and
realised I'd forgotten what half of it did.
-I define a few custom per-filetype rules for stuff I often edit in
+If the logic for doing something involves more than a few lines or any
+structures like functions, I like to implement it as a plugin in
+`~/.vim/plugin` and/or `~/.vim/autoload`. There's documentation for each of
+those in `~/.vim/doc`.
+I also define a few custom per-filetype rules for stuff I often edit in
`~/.vim/ftplugin`, including some local mappings for checking, linting, and
+Any/all of the general or filetype plugins may eventually be spun off into
+their own repositories in the future, but for the moment they live here.
+Contact me if you find one of them useful and you'd like to see it in its own
Third-party plugins are in submodules in `~/.vim/bundle`, loaded using Tim